ResumoIn the Alboran Domain, the Alpujarride/Nevado-Filabride major boundary is a brittleductile and brittle detachment (Filabres Extensional Detachment, FED) which thinned the Nevado-Filabride complex during the Miocene. The FED and their associated low-angle normal faults in the footwall cut across the Calar Alto and Bedar-Macael nappes, decreasing complex thickness by more than 5 km. The angle between the fault zones and the mylonitic foliation of the Nevado-Filabride shear zones is <20° and very often <10o, the hangingwall being displaced towards N190-270E (maximum SW). The FEO, folded during the Upper Miocene, is consistent with the variation of the crustal thickness between the Northern Sierra Nevada and the Mediterranean coastal region (Alboran crustal thinning).
